FAQ
What factors affect farm gate installation costs in Greensboro?
The cost of farm gate installation in Greensboro depends on the gate size, material, and complexity of the installation site. Additional factors like concrete footings or custom hardware can also influence the price.
Do I need a permit for farm gate installation in Greensboro, North Carolina?
Permit requirements for farm gate installation vary by locality. In Greensboro, North Carolina, it's best to check with your local building department to determine if a permit is needed based on gate height, location, and local regulations.
Can I install a farm gate myself or should I hire a professional?
While DIY installation is possible, hiring a professional in Greensboro ensures proper alignment, support, and safety, which is especially important for heavy farm gates. Professionals have the tools and experience to handle challenging terrain and gate sizes.
How long does a typical farm gate installation take in Greensboro?
The duration varies with gate type and site conditions. A standard single gate installation by a professional in Greensboro commonly takes a few hours to a full day, but custom or heavy duty gates may require more time.
